What You’ll Do
- Support agency compliance by following state and federal regulations, including policies related to abuse, neglect, and exploitation.
- Answer and route calls from clinicians, patients, and caregivers while providing exceptional customer service.
- Retrieve and manage clinical documentation to support scheduling and patient care.
- Ensure all protected health information is properly handled and redacted in accordance with HIPAA guidelines.
- Assist the scheduling team by coordinating communication between clinicians and patients.
- Maintain accurate documentation and provide administrative support to multiple departments.
- Foster professional communication that helps ensure outstanding patient care.
Qualifications
- High school diploma or equivalent required.
- Minimum of six (6) months of experience in a healthcare-related field.
- Home Health experience preferred.
- Basic computer proficiency with the ability to learn new software systems.
- Reliable transportation, valid driver’s license, and current automobile insurance (or the ability to use public transportation).
